Jami Carey, LMFTA
Taking that first step to begin counseling is not an easy task. It takes courage, and I have a deep respect for that. It is a privilege for me to come alongside you in your journey towards your goals, and I provide a safe space to help you achieve those goals. I believe our relationships and experiences throughout our lives shape how we think and act, so I consider all aspects of wellness in the therapeutic process: mental, physical, emotional, spiritual, and relational. I primarily use EFT (Emotionally Focused Therapy), EFiT, Narrative Therapy, and SandTray therapy, but I incorporate and adjust therapies to meet the needs of each individual, couple, and family.
I have loved helping others for as long as I can remember. It is a passion the Lord placed on my heart many years ago, and for over 30 years, I have helped others as a registered nurse. Throughout my time as a registered nurse, the Lord kept whispering to my heart that I would be helping others emotionally through counseling. I finally went back to school and earned my Master of Arts in Marriage and Family Therapy from Indiana Wesleyan University. My desire is to use my experiences and knowledge to continue to help others be the best version of themselves and live out their God-given strengths.
